Thanks, Arun Patidar On Wed, Jul 8, 2026 at 10:45 AM Divesh Dutta <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i all, > > As a follow-up to the discussion on the Production Run PWA, I would like to > propose creating a dedicated repository for PWA applications built on top > of Apache OFBiz. > > The idea is to keep the OFBiz framework, business applications, plugins, > services, and REST APIs in their existing repositories, while maintaining > frontend applications that consume those APIs in a separate repository. > > PWAs have their own development lifecycle, build tooling, dependencies, and > release cadence. > They are deployed independently from an OFBiz server and can be developed > using different frontend technologies depending on the use case. Keeping > them in a dedicated repository would allow the frontend ecosystem around > OFBiz to evolve independently while keeping a clear separation between > backend and frontend concerns. > > Such a repository could eventually host applications such as: > > > - Manufacturing PWAs (Production Runs, BOM, Routing, MRP) > > > - Fulfillment PWAs (Picking, Packing) > > > - Inventory PWAs (Receiving, Cycle Counting) > > > - Other API-driven frontend applications built on Apache OFBiz > > > This would also provide a common place for sharing frontend libraries, API > clients, authentication helpers, UI components, and documentation where > appropriate. > > I am interested in hearing the community's thoughts on whether a dedicated > repository for Apache OFBiz PWAs would be a good long-term direction. > > Thanks > -- > Divesh Dutta > www.hotwaxsystems.com >
